153.23 DISCIPLINARY INVESTIGATION.
    Subdivision 1. Malpractice complaints. Whenever the files maintained by the board show
that a podiatric medical malpractice settlement or award to the plaintiff has been made against a
podiatrist as reported by insurers, the executive director may initiate a complaint under section
214.10.
    Subd. 2. Access to hospital records. The board has access to hospital and medical records
of a patient treated by the podiatrist under review if the patient signs a written consent permitting
that access. If no consent form has been signed, the hospital or podiatrist shall first delete data in
the record that identifies the patient before providing it to the board.
History: 1987 c 108 s 12
